Join a team that is shaping leadership and capability development across the organisation and making a meaningful impact on people, performance, and culture. In this role, you will be responsible for the planning, coordination, and delivery of a diverse portfolio of leadership and capability development projects and initiatives, ensuring outcomes are delivered on time, within scope and aligned to strategic priorities.
Project management will be a core focus, with responsibility for managing multiple concurrent projects, maintaining project plans, tracking milestones, coordinating resources, managing risks and dependencies, and ensuring accurate documentation and reporting. You will play a key role in driving project governance, providing visibility of progress, and supporting effective decision-making through clear reporting and insights.
Strong stakeholder engagement and relationship management skills will be essential. You will work across a broad network of stakeholders to work towards aligning priorities, collaborate, coordinate working groups and ensure successful execution of project deliverables. The ability to influence, communicate effectively and manage competing priorities will be critical to success.
You will also oversee the maintenance and continuous improvement of project-related systems, tools, and digital resources, identifying opportunities to leverage technology, improve efficiency and enhance the overall delivery experience. Through process optimisation and project discipline, you will contribute to the successful implementation of both strategic initiatives and business-as-usual activities.
You will help identify efficiencies, streamline operational processes, and contribute to the ongoing evolution of leadership and capability initiatives.
The role offers the opportunity to manage and support a range of leadership and capability projects, balancing day-to-day operational delivery with the execution of new initiatives and continuous improvement activities.

You are an agile and adaptable professional with experience in project coordination, program delivery, process improvement or a related field, enabling you to effectively manage multiple priorities in a dynamic environment.
Your strong organisational skills and proactive approach are complemented by the ability to build productive relationships with a diverse range of stakeholders. You are confident working with data, systems and digital tools, and can identify opportunities to improve processes, enhance efficiency and support successful outcomes.
You bring a growth mindset, curiosity, and a willingness to learn, along with the confidence to take initiative and contribute new ideas. You enjoy working collaboratively, solving problems and delivering high-quality outcomes in a fast-paced environment.
We welcome candidates from a variety of professional backgrounds, including project management, program coordination, operations, policy, change, HR, People & Culture, capability, learning and development or related disciplines. What's most important is your ability to coordinate initiatives, engage stakeholders, manage competing priorities, and contribute to the successful delivery of strategic and operational outcomes.
